What is marine mammal authorization program

The Marine Mammal Authorization Program Registration Form is a permit application used by commercial fishing vessel owners to obtain authorization for the incidental take of marine mammals as mandated by the Marine Mammal Protection Act.

Comprehensive Guide to marine mammal authorization program

What is the Marine Mammal Authorization Program Registration Form?

The Marine Mammal Authorization Program Registration Form is an essential tool in the conservation of marine mammals, as mandated by the Marine Mammal Protection Act. This form is designed specifically for owners of commercial fishing vessels engaged in Category I or II fisheries to obtain the necessary authorization for incidental take of marine mammals.
This registration form outlines key details about the vessel, its owners, and operators. By completing this form accurately, vessel owners can ensure compliance with regulations aimed at protecting marine mammals and their habitats.

Purpose and Benefits of the Marine Mammal Authorization Program Registration Form

The primary purpose of the Marine Mammal Authorization Program Registration Form is to obtain authorization for incidental take of marine mammals. This authorization is vital for vessel owners engaged in commercial fishing, enabling them to operate legally within the framework of the Marine Mammal Protection Act.
By acquiring incidental take authorization, owners can enhance their operational flexibility while fulfilling legal obligations. Compliance not only protects marine species but also facilitates smoother interactions between the fishing industry and regulatory bodies.

Who Needs the Marine Mammal Authorization Program Registration Form?

This registration form is required for specific categories of vessel owners and fishing industry representatives. Eligible parties include owners of commercial fishing vessels that operate within designated fisheries known as Category I or II fisheries.
Those who need to apply typically represent businesses that participate in activities that might impact marine mammals, ensuring they can stay compliant with required regulations.

Understanding Submission Guidelines for the Marine Mammal Authorization Program Registration Form

Upon completing the Marine Mammal Authorization Program Registration Form, applicants must follow specific submission guidelines. The completed form should be mailed to the nearest National Marine Fisheries Service (NMFS) regional office.
In addition to mailing instructions, each application comes with a processing fee which must be paid at the time of submission. This fee is essential for covering the operational costs associated with processing applications.

Owners of commercial fishing vessels engaged in Category I or II fisheries are eligible to use this form to obtain authorization for incidental takes of marine mammals under the Marine Mammal Protection Act.
Yes, there is a processing fee of $25 required when submitting the Marine Mammal Authorization Program Registration Form. Be sure to include this fee to avoid any processing delays.
The completed form must be mailed to your nearest National Marine Fisheries Service (NMFS) regional office. Check the NMFS website for the office addresses to ensure correct submission.
You will need detailed information about your vessel, such as its registration number, operator details, and owner identities, along with contact information and particulars about the fishing activities planned.
Common mistakes include omitting signature fields, not providing accurate vessel information, and forgetting to include the processing fee. Always double-check your entries for completeness and accuracy before submission.
Processing times can vary based on the volume of applications received by the NMFS. It’s advisable to submit your application well in advance to allow adequate time for processing, especially if you have fishing activities planned.
No, notarization is not required for the Marine Mammal Authorization Program Registration Form. However, it must be signed under penalty of perjury by the vessel owner or an authorized representative.
